LeAnne Dlamini isn’t happy with 90% local music

Cape Town - Musician LeAnne Dlamini went on a mini Instagram rant, complaining about the quality of local music being played on SABC radio.

"I feel like they aren't filtering what's being played. They aren't giving us music with good song writing, lyrical content and good production," she said in the Instagram video. 

"It completely turns the listener off. Lets spread it across all genres, lets hear some good quality music." 

She goes on the mention several female artists on her radar that she would love to hear more of. 

She ends off by saying that she has resorted to listening to Highveld Radio, who sadly refuses to play her music. "I just can't listen to bad music."
